Asher
ASH-er
A Hebrew name meaning "happy" or "blessed," Asher has a gentle strength and contemporary feel. It's a popular choice with biblical roots.
Popular
Owen
OH-en
A Welsh name meaning "noble" or "well-born," Owen is a timeless classic that feels fresh and modern. It has literary ties and a simple, strong sound.
Classic
Silas
SY-las
Derived from the Roman name Silvanus, meaning "of the forest," Silas is a nature-inspired name with a vintage charm. It is experiencing a resurgence in popularity.
Trending
Milo
MY-loh
A German name, possibly derived from the Latin word for "soldier" or the Slavic element "mil" meaning "gracious." Milo is short, sweet, and stylish.
Popular
Jasper
JAS-per
A Persian name meaning "bringer of treasure," Jasper is a gemstone name with a sophisticated and adventurous feel. It's been steadily climbing the charts.
Trending
Leo
LEE-oh
A Latin name meaning "lion," Leo is a strong and regal name that exudes confidence and charm. It is consistently popular across many cultures.
Popular
Theodore
THEE-uh-dor
A Greek name meaning "gift of God," Theodore is a classic with a warm and comforting feel. Nickname Theo adds a modern touch.
Classic
Arlo
AHR-loh
Of uncertain origin, possibly derived from the Spanish "barlo," meaning "barberry tree." Arlo has a cool, vintage vibe and is gaining popularity.
Trending
Finn
FIN
An Irish name meaning "fair" or "white," Finn is a short and sweet name with a playful and adventurous spirit. It is popular in many English-speaking countries.
Popular
Atticus
AT-i-kus
A Latin name meaning "from Attica," Atticus gained popularity from the character in "To Kill a Mockingbird." It symbolizes wisdom and justice.
Trending
Ezra
EZ-rah
A Hebrew name meaning "helper," Ezra has a strong and soulful quality. It's a popular biblical name with a modern appeal.
Popular
Hugo
HYOO-goh
A German name meaning "mind" or "intellect," Hugo is a sophisticated and charming name with a vintage feel. It's gaining popularity in the US.
Trending
Silvan
SIL-van
A Latin name meaning "of the forest." Silvan is a nature-inspired name with a strong and earthy quality.
Rare/Unique
Felix
FEE-liks
A Latin name meaning "lucky" or "successful," Felix is a cheerful and upbeat name. It is a classic choice with a modern twist.
Classic
Oliver
OL-i-ver
A French name meaning "olive tree," Oliver is a popular and timeless name. It evokes peace and fruitfulness and is consistently ranked high.
Popular
Liam
LEE-am
An Irish name, short for William, meaning "resolute protector." Liam is a strong and popular choice that has topped charts in recent years.
Popular
Ethan
EE-than
A Hebrew name meaning "strong" or "enduring," Ethan is a solid and reliable choice. It is a consistently popular biblical name.
Popular
Rowan
ROH-an
Of Irish and Scottish origin, Rowan refers to a tree known for its vibrant red berries and protective qualities. It is a nature-inspired and gender-neutral name.
Trending
Asa
AY-sah
A Hebrew name meaning "healer" or "physician." Asa is a short and uncommon biblical name with a gentle strength.
Rare/Unique
August
AW-gust
A Latin name meaning "venerable" or "exalted," August has a dignified and classic feel. The nickname Auggie adds a playful touch.
Trending
Caspian
KAS-pee-en
A geographical name referring to the Caspian Sea. It gained popularity from the "Chronicles of Narnia" series and evokes adventure.
Rare/Unique
Axel
AK-sul
A Scandinavian name, a medieval form of Absalom, meaning "father of peace." Axel is a strong and edgy name with a cool vibe.
Trending
Luca
LOO-kah
An Italian name derived from the Latin name Lucas, meaning "bringer of light." Luca is a charming and popular choice.
Popular
Rhys
REES
A Welsh name meaning "ardor" or "fiery." Rhys is a short and strong name with a mysterious and cool feel.

How to Choose: 5 Tips

Say it out loud — Test how the name sounds with your last name and as a full name.
Check the initials — Make sure the initials don't spell anything awkward.
Think about nicknames — Consider what the name shortens to naturally.
Cultural fit — Reflect on the name's origin and how it fits your family background.
Future-proof it — Imagine the name on a resume, not just a baby onesie.

Frequently Asked Questions

What makes a baby boy name "modern"?
A modern baby boy name often feels fresh, stylish, and current, reflecting contemporary tastes and trends. This can include names that are newly popular, have a sleek sound, or break from traditional naming conventions, while still being accessible and easy to pronounce. Ultimately, a modern name resonates with parents looking for something distinctive yet timeless for their son.
Are modern names trendy or timeless?
Modern names can be both trendy and timeless! Some modern names are fleeting trends that rise and fall quickly in popularity. Others, however, possess qualities that allow them to endure over time, becoming modern classics that remain stylish for generations.
Where can I find inspiration for modern baby boy names?
Inspiration for modern baby boy names can be found everywhere! Look to popular culture, including movies, TV shows, and music. Consider names of athletes, artists, and innovators. Baby name websites, social media groups, and even travel destinations can spark ideas.
How do I choose a modern name that won't sound dated in a few years?
To choose a modern name with staying power, consider its overall sound, meaning, and origins. Opt for names that have a classic element or are rooted in history, even if they are currently trending. Avoid names that are strongly associated with a specific time period or trend.
Should I worry about popularity when choosing a modern baby boy name?
The level of popularity you're comfortable with is a personal choice. If you prefer a truly unique name, you might want to avoid names that are currently in the top 10 or 20. However, many popular modern names are well-loved for a reason – they sound great and have positive associations, so don't rule them out entirely.
